In influenza vaccine development, Madin-Darby canine kidney (MDCK) cells provide multiple advantages, including large-scale production and egg independence. Several cell-based influenza vaccines have been approved worldwide. We cultured H5N1 virus in a serum-free MDCK cell suspension. The harvested virus was manufactured into vaccines after inactivation and purification. The vaccine effectiveness was assessed in the Wuhan Institute of Biological Products BSL2 facility. The pre- and postvaccination mouse serum titers were determined using the microneutralization and hemagglutination inhibition tests. The immunological responses induced by vaccine were investigated using immunological cell classification, cytokine expression quantification, and immunoglobulin G (IgG) subtype classification. The protective effect of the vaccine in mice was evaluated using challenge test. Antibodies against H5N1 in rats lasted up to 8 months after the first dose. Compared with those of the placebo group, the serum titer of vaccinated mice increased significantly, Th1 and Th2 cells were activated, and CD8+ T cells were activated in two dose groups. Furthermore, the challenge test showed that vaccination reduced the clinical symptoms and virus titer in the lungs of mice after challenge, indicating a superior immunological response. Notably, early after vaccination, considerably increased interferon-inducible protein-10 (IP-10) levels were found, indicating improved vaccine-induced innate immunity. However, IP-10 is an adverse event marker, which is a cause for concern. Overall, in the case of an outbreak, the whole-virion H5N1 vaccine should provide protection.

BACKGROUND: Respiratory infections caused by influenza viruses spread rapidly, resulting in significant annual morbidity and mortality worldwide. Currently, the most effective public health measure against infection is immunisation with an influenza vaccine matching the relevant circulating influenza strains. Although a number of developments in terms of influenza vaccine production, safety and immunogenicity have been reported, limitations in our understanding of vaccine stability still exist. In this report we seek to identify compounds that increase influenza vaccine thermostability. METHODS: We use plaque inhibition on confluent MDCK cells to identify compounds which inhibit the entry of various seed strain viruses. The effect of these compounds on vaccine thermal lability is evaluated through SRID analysis. The significance of these results is tested by a two-way analysis of variance (ANOVA) method. RESULTS: We identify two compounds which selectively inhibit entry of different group I or group II influenza strains through prevention of the neutral-pH to low-pH conformational change of hemagglutinin. Compounds which were able to inhibit virus entry were also able to limit thermally induced potency loss in matched influenza vaccines. Furthermore, we demonstrate that this effect is independent of product formulation or the presence of multiple HA types. CONCLUSIONS: This work provides further evidence for a link between HA conformational stability in the virus and thermostability of the corresponding vaccine preparation. It also suggests straightforward approaches to improve the stability and predictability of influenza vaccine preparations.

OBJECTIVE: To demonstrate the prevalence of hyperuricemia and gout associated with dietary and lifestyle changes and evaluate the implication of metabolic disorders to the development of hyperuricemia. METHODS: Data collected from 5,003 subjects randomly recruited from 5 coastal cities (Qingdao, Rizhao, Yantai, Weihai, and Dongying) of Shandong province in Eastern China were analyzed. RESULTS: Overall, the prevalence for hyperuricemia and gout in the studied populations was 13.19% and 1.14%, respectively. The prevalence was significantly higher in men as compared to women (18.32% vs 8.56% for hyperuricemia, 1.94% vs 0.42% for gout). Hyperuricemia was more common in men over age 30 and in women over age 50. A significant steady increase for the prevalence was noted as compared to the previous published data. Urban residents showed much higher prevalence of hyperuricemia as compared to rural residents (14.9% vs 10.1%, p = 0.004). Similarly, higher prevalence was noted in the developed city compared to the less developed city (18.02 vs 5.3%). These discrepancies were highly correlated with economic development as manifested by the increase of daily consumption of meat and seafood. Additionally, alcohol, overweight or obesity, hypertension, and abnormal triglycerides were highly associated with higher prevalence of hyperuricemia. Moreover, hyperuricemia is likely a risk factor for the development of diabetes mellitus. CONCLUSION: There was a remarkable increase for the prevalence of hyperuricemia and gout, which is highly correlated with the development of the economy as manifested by dietary and lifestyle changes.
